Kukho iintlobo ezintathu zeinkqubo yogwebu: zimileinkqubo yogwebu, enamandlainkqubo yogwebukunye nendibaniselwano yenkqubo yogwebu eguqukayo kunye ne-static.Emva kokulungelelaniswa nokulinganiswa ngokwahlukeneyo, iiarhente yogwebu, amanzi, kunye nomoya ocinezelweyo uya kungena kwezi nkqubo zintathu zingasentla.Phakathi kwabo, i-dynamicinkqubo yogwebuineendlela ezimbini zempompo enye yepini yohlobo lwempompo yogwebu kunye nempompo ephindwe kabini yogwebu ephakathi kubasebenzisi abangayikhetha.

Iinkqubo yogwebuyinxalenye ebalulekileyo yeumgca wokuvelisa ibhodi yegypsum, idlala indima ephambili kwinkqubo yokuvelisa.Le nkqubo inoxanduva lokudala i-foam esetyenziselwa ukwenza i-core yebhodi ye-gypsum, inikezela ngezinto eziyimfuneko ezilula kunye ne-insulating.

Kwimveliso yebhodi yegypsum, iinkqubo yogwebuidityaniswe ngokwesiqhelo kumxube, apho idibanisa amanzi,iarhente yogwebu, kunye nomoya ukwenza umxube we-foam.Lo mxube we-foam ungeniswa kwi-gypsum slurry, apho iyanda kwaye yenza i-core yebhodi ye-gypsum.Iinkqubo yogwebukufuneka ilinganiswe ngononophelo ukuqinisekisa ubuninzi obufanelekileyo kunye nokuhambelana kwe-foam, njengoko oku kuchaphazela ngokuthe ngqo umgangatho webhodi ye-gypsum egqityiweyo.

Kukho izinto ezininzi ezibalulekileyo ekufuneka ziqwalaselwe xa kuyilwa naxa kuphunyezwa ainkqubo yogwebukwimveliso yebhodi yegypsum.Iiarhente yogwebuesetyenzisiweyo kufuneka ikhethwe ngononophelo ukuqinisekisa ukuhambelana ne-gypsum slurry kunye nokufezekisa iimpawu ezifunwayo ze-foam.Ukongeza, iinkqubo yogwebukufuneka ilungiselelwe ukuhambisa i-foam engaguqukiyo kunye nefanayo kuyo yonke inkqubo yokuvelisa, njengoko ukuhlukahluka kobuninzi be-foam kunokukhokelela ekungahambelani kwibhodi ye-gypsum egqityiweyo.

Ukusebenza kakuhle kunye nokuthembeka kwakhona kubalulekile ingqalelo xa kufikwa kwiinkqubo yogwebu.Inkqubo kufuneka iyilwe ukuba isebenze kakuhle kwaye ingaguquguquki, ukunciphisa ixesha lokuphumla kunye nokuqinisekisa ukuhamba okuqhubekayo kwemveliso.Ukugcinwa ngokufanelekileyo kunye nokubekwa kweliso kweinkqubo yogwebuzibalulekile ukuthintela imiba efana nokuvala okanye ukuhanjiswa kwamagwebu ngokungalinganiyo, okunokuchaphazela umgangatho opheleleyo webhodi yegypsum.

Iinkqubo yogwebuyinxalenye ebalulekileyo yomgca wokuvelisa ibhodi ye-gypsum, igalelo kwiipropati ezilula kunye ne-insulating yemveliso egqityiweyo.Ukuqwalaselwa ngononophelo kuyilo, ukusebenza, kunye nokugcinwa kweinkqubo yogwebukubalulekile ukuqinisekisa ukuveliswa okungaguquguqukiyo kwebhodi yegypsum ephezulu.Ngokwenza ngcono iinkqubo yogwebu, sinokuphucula ukusebenza kunye nokuthembeka kwenkqubo yabo yokuvelisa, ekugqibeleni sikhokelela kwiimveliso eziphezulu zebhodi ye-gypsum,ugwebuiarhenteidlala indima ebalulekileyo kule nkqubo.

Ngoko iphi ibhodi yegypsumiarhente yogwebuFaka isicelo se?

Ibhodi yeGypsumiarhente yogwebu: isetyenziselwa ukwenza ugwebu lwegypsum kwinkqubo yokuveliswa kwebhodi yegypsum yephepha.Niniiarhente yogwebukunye negypsum zi-hydrated, i-intermolecular Forces_hydrogen bond iya kuveliswa ukuvelisa isithintelo sesteric.Ibhodi yeGypsumiarhente yogwebukubangela isiphene se-gypsum crystal structure, ikhuthaza umsebenzi we-gypsum kwaye isantya ukuya kwisakhelo se-gypsum yomnatha, ngale ndlela, ukwandisa amandla e-gypsum, ukunciphisa umthamo wayo, ukugcina izinto eziluhlaza kakhulu kunye nokuphucula ngokupheleleyo ukusebenza komzimba webhodi yegypsum.

I-agent ye-foaming isetyenziselwa i-plasterboard okanye ibhodi ye-gypsum njengento ekrwada.Ii-agent zogwebu kwiibhodi ze-gypsum zisekelwe kwisakhono sokuvelisa amaqamza omoya kunye nesakhiwo esisodwa esikhokelela ekubunjweni kwe-foam eninzi kwaye ezinzileyo ekhokelela ekuphuculeni amandla ebhodi kunye nokunciphisa umthamo kunye nobuninzi bebhodi.Oku kwenza ukuba kugcinwe imali eninzi kwiindleko zempahla ekrwada.
